Industrial Ergonomics Videos, DVDs, Posters, Booklets and more
Industrial ergonomics applies to all work environments, such as those found in manufacturing, engineering, and construction. Some tools often demands total body involvement to operate; not just fingers, arms, and hands. These operations may require standing or sitting in one position for extended periods of time, repetitious movements, or excessive force; this causes Static Posture. Stationary postures or excessive movement of any type can stress the spine and, depending on the actions needed to operate the tool, can cause neck and back problems. Static posture and stationary posture can both lead to Work-related Musculoskeletal Disorders (WMSDs) if left untreated.
